Btools-vue
Btools-vue copied to clipboard
前几天开始视频封面按钮没了
似乎是B站更新了什么东西,当未登录时封面按钮还在,但登录后却没了,换了几个chrome内核的浏览器都是如此。
我好像没遇到,是普通视频么 还是番剧、电影
我好像没遇到,是普通视频么 还是番剧、电影
所有视频都是
我好像没遇到,是普通视频么 还是番剧、电影
我发现了,按钮不是没了,是位置跑到屏幕外面去了。 打开f12后
<div class="btools-get-pic-video" btools-bind-hkm-id="9c7mS1jz" ondragstart="return false;" style="top: 10px; left: -40px;">
会发现这一行末尾," style="top: 10px; left: -40px;"这两个坐标有问题,同一个视频登录前还是top: 162px; left: 737.5px,这是正常的位置。登陆后所有视频都变成了10,-40这个奇怪的坐标,手动改数值能暂时让按钮回来。
按说这个按钮位置是根据视频播放器定位的,而且好像是监听页面大小实时调整位置的,有可能是播放器id
或者class
换了
我好像没遇到,是普通视频么 还是番剧、电影
我发现了,按钮不是没了,是位置跑到屏幕外面去了。 打开f12后
<div class="btools-get-pic-video" btools-bind-hkm-id="9c7mS1jz" ondragstart="return false;" style="top: 10px; left: -40px;">
会发现这一行末尾," style="top: 10px; left: -40px;"这两个坐标有问题,同一个视频登录前还是top: 162px; left: 737.5px,这是正常的位置。登陆后所有视频都变成了10,-40这个奇怪的坐标,手动改数值能暂时让按钮回来。
emmm,试了一下,我这里是能正常定位的,会根据页面大小定位到播放器左侧 目前不太清楚你那边是啥情况,没法复现
我好像没遇到,是普通视频么 还是番剧、电影
我发现了,按钮不是没了,是位置跑到屏幕外面去了。 打开f12后
<div class="btools-get-pic-video" btools-bind-hkm-id="9c7mS1jz" ondragstart="return false;" style="top: 10px; left: -40px;">
会发现这一行末尾," style="top: 10px; left: -40px;"这两个坐标有问题,同一个视频登录前还是top: 162px; left: 737.5px,这是正常的位置。登陆后所有视频都变成了10,-40这个奇怪的坐标,手动改数值能暂时让按钮回来。
emmm,试了一下,我这里是能正常定位的,会根据页面大小定位到播放器左侧 目前不太清楚你那边是啥情况,没法复现
10,-40这个坐标刚好差不多是正常显示的时候相对于视频左上角的坐标,但是变成了相对于整个页面左上角的坐标。我又试了下firefox,还是这样,未登录时是正常的,一登录就跑到屏幕外去了。
10,-40这个坐标刚好差不多是正常显示的时候相对于视频左上角的坐标,但是变成了相对于整个页面左上角的坐标。我又试了下firefox,还是这样,未登录时是正常的,一登录就跑到屏幕外去了。
可能改了什么东西在灰度测试,因为我这里目前还是正常的,再等等吧,正式发布了我这边再改
10,-40这个坐标刚好差不多是正常显示的时候相对于视频左上角的坐标,但是变成了相对于整个页面左上角的坐标。我又试了下firefox,还是这样,未登录时是正常的,一登录就跑到屏幕外去了。
可能改了什么东西在灰度测试,因为我这里目前还是正常的,再等等吧,正式发布了我这边再改
感觉有可能是B站的问题,因为现在有新版和旧版两种不同的视频页面。我用有的浏览器在未登录时是新版页面,封面按钮也是正常的。但用有的浏览器即使退出登录也无法在视频页面用新版,只有首页能切换新版。而所有浏览器登录后都无法在视频页面用新版。说明新版页面并没有推送给所有人,也许还在测试。我猜是这个造成的。
10,-40这个坐标刚好差不多是正常显示的时候相对于视频左上角的坐标,但是变成了相对于整个页面左上角的坐标。我又试了下firefox,还是这样,未登录时是正常的,一登录就跑到屏幕外去了。
可能改了什么东西在灰度测试,因为我这里目前还是正常的,再等等吧,正式发布了我这边再改
今天恢复正常了,应该是B站的播放页也正式改成新版了。